4.  Coconut Mojito at China Grill, Fort Lauderdale Hilton
2 oz. Bacardi Coconut Rum
Splash of Coco Lopez Cream of Coconut
Fresh mint leaves (6-10) 
1 lime quartered
Soda water 
Muddle lime and mint together. Fill glass with ice. Add Bacardi and Coco Lopez. Fill remainder of glass with soda water and stir.

3. Colorful Fourth of July Cocktail 
1 1/2 ounce vodka 
1/2 ounce triple sec 
1/2 ounce sweet & sour 
1/2 ounce blue curacao 
1 dash grenadine 
Mix all ingredients, except grenadine, in a shaker and chill. Serve in a martini glass. Add grenadine. 

2. Stars and Stripes Martini
Muddled blueberries 
1.5 oz. SKYY Citrus Vodka 
¼ oz. blue curacao 
¼ oz. Chambord raspberry liqueur 
½ oz. simple syrup 
1 oz. lemonade 
Splash lemon-lime soda 
2 juiced lemons 
Muddle blueberries with the blue curacao in a martini glass. Place a lemon wheel slice over mixture. Pour vodka, simple syrup, a splash of lemon-lime soda, and lemon juice in a martini shaker. Shake and strain over the lemon in a martini glass. The mixture will layer. Drizzle Chambord down the side of the glass. It will layer in between the vodka and blueberry mixture creating a striped appearance; garnish will float to top.

1. Red, White & Vodka by Eben Freeman, AltaMarea Group, NYC 
1 oz. PAMA Pomegranate Liqueur 
1 oz. vodka 
1 oz. white chocolate liqueur 
0.5 oz. simple syrup 
 Combine all ingredients in a shaker. 
Add ice and shake vigorously. Strain into a chilled martini glass and garnish by floating pomegranate seeds on top.
